The School of Engineering at the University of British Columbia (UBC) invites applications for one Research Associate position in the battery group supervised by Dr. Jian Liu. This position will be located at UBC's Okanagan campus and is available immediately. 

Qualifications of the applicant

Essential:

Have completed a relevant Ph.D. in materials science, electrochemistry, or chemistry.

Be highly motivated, organized, a good communicator (written and verbal), and passionate about battery research.

Thrive in a team environment and mentoring/team-building role.

Have a strong desire to conduct transformational research in close collaboration with the industry.

Previous research experience in one or more of the following areas in supercapacitor or battery technologies is required (pouch cell assembly and testing, electrode and electrolyte for supercapacitors; lithium metal anode, solid electrolyte, solid-state cathode, solid-state battery assembly and characterization).

Responsibilities and training:

Lead the execution and delivery of industry-sponsored projects on batteries and supercapacitors.

Interface with industry and other stakeholders to identify needs and resources, formulate project plans, and ensure timely deliverables.

Communicate regularly with the industrial partners to update progress, receive guidance on new assignments, make preliminary selections of technical alternatives, and independently complete recurring assignments.

Deliver clear and concise written and oral presentations of data, analysis, and internal/external reports. Prepare manuscripts for publications if appropriate.

Develop standard operating procedures (SOPs) for the new battery facility at UBC and manage its daily operations.

Mentor and assist students in both technical and safety matters.

 

Duration & Salary:

This position has an initial 1-year appointment, with the potential for annual renewal/promotion.

The salary starts at $75,000/year minimum (plus benefits) and is commensurate with qualifications.

The anticipated start date is as soon as possible (negotiable). Review of applications will start immediately and continue until the position is filled.
